Grunt Speak

Old Breed

Definition

Veterans from previous generations who had it harder (according to them), tougher (according to them), and better (debatable, according to everyone else). Every era has an Old Breed looking down.

Example Usage

"The Old Breed says we're soft. The Old Breed also didn't have body armor and air conditioning, which explains a lot."
